Describes surroundings

The voice assistant continuously describes what's in front of you: objects, people, the path.

Reads text aloud

Reads a letter, label, medication leaflet or menu. Recognition runs on your device.

Warns about obstacles

Voice and vibration warn you about obstacles: curbs, steps, posts. The closer you are, the stronger the vibration.

Automatic mode

The app comments on your surroundings on its own when the scene changes.

Helps find things

Say what you're looking for and the app guides you to it.

Recognizes people

Describes people nearby, what they're doing and even their emotions.

Zooms in

Read a bus number or a street name from a distance.

Works after dark

In low light the app lights up the scene automatically.

Compass and time

Ask for a compass direction or the current time.

Fully accessible

VoiceOver, large buttons, haptics and audio cues.

This is what Ariadne sounds like

This is what the app's prompts sound like while moving:

  • Car on the left, nearby.
  • Step down on the right, very close.
  • Path straight ahead.
  • Door on the left, within reach.

Always the same structure: what, which side, how far.
